Presidio Property Trust, Inc. (SQFT) Business Profile

Company Overview

Presidio Property Trust, Inc. (NASDAQ: SQFT) is a diversified real estate investment trust (REIT) headquartered in San Diego, California. The company was founded in 1999 and has since evolved into a prominent player in the real estate sector, focusing on commercial and residential properties. Presidio Property Trust operates under the leadership of its CEO, Jack Heilbron, who has extensive experience in real estate investment and management. The company’s executive team is complemented by a board of directors with deep expertise in finance, real estate, and corporate governance.

Presidio Property Trust is known for its strategic approach to property acquisition, development, and management. The company’s portfolio spans multiple states across the U.S., with a focus on secondary and tertiary markets. By targeting these markets, Presidio Property Trust aims to capitalize on opportunities that are often overlooked by larger REITs, providing a unique value proposition to its investors.

Core Business Segments

Presidio Property Trust operates across two primary business segments: commercial real estate and residential real estate. Each segment is designed to cater to specific market needs and generate diversified revenue streams.

Commercial Real Estate

The commercial real estate segment includes office buildings, retail spaces, and industrial properties. Presidio Property Trust focuses on acquiring and managing properties in suburban and secondary markets, where demand for commercial spaces remains steady. Key offerings under this segment include:

  • Office Spaces: The company owns and manages office buildings that cater to small and medium-sized businesses. These properties are strategically located to provide easy access and convenience for tenants.
  • Retail Properties: Presidio Property Trust invests in retail spaces that serve local communities, including shopping centers and standalone retail outlets.
  • Industrial Properties: The company’s industrial properties are designed to meet the needs of logistics and manufacturing businesses, offering flexible spaces and modern amenities.

Residential Real Estate

In the residential real estate segment, Presidio Property Trust focuses on single-family homes and multi-family units. The company’s residential properties are primarily located in high-demand areas, ensuring steady occupancy rates and rental income. Key offerings include:

  • Single-Family Homes: Presidio Property Trust acquires and manages single-family homes in desirable neighborhoods, targeting families and professionals.
  • Multi-Family Units: The company’s multi-family properties cater to a diverse tenant base, including students, young professionals, and retirees.

Competitive Landscape

Presidio Property Trust operates in a competitive real estate market, facing competition from both large and small REITs. Key competitors include:

  • Realty Income Corporation: A leading REIT specializing in commercial properties with a focus on retail and industrial spaces.
  • American Homes 4 Rent: A REIT focused on single-family rental homes, competing directly with Presidio Property Trust’s residential segment.
  • Prologis, Inc.: A global leader in industrial real estate, competing with Presidio Property Trust’s industrial properties.
  • Regional and Local REITs: Smaller REITs operating in specific markets also pose competition, particularly in secondary and tertiary markets.
